These expositions of the Book of Acts were first presented to the congregation of Tenth Presbyterian Church in Philadelphia, a church that Donald Barnhouse pastored for 33 years. The messages capture the central meaning and practical applications of each of the twenty-eight chapters of Acts to make the book a powerful influence in the lives of Christians today. The late Donald Grey Barnhouse, for many years pastor of Tenth Presbyterian Church in Philadelphia, was the founder of the Evangelical Foundation (now Evangelical Ministries), the radio voice of the Bible Study Hour, and Editor of Eternity magazine. Dr. Barnhouse was renowned as a Bible expositor and teacher and was recognized as one of America's great preachers and conference speakers.
